Описание: Hunter Fitzhugh left St. Louis in 1897 dreaming of fortune and adventure, bound for the Yukon Territory, where it was rumored that nuggets of gold simply littered the ground, waiting to make a man rich. Hunter soon discovered the reality of the land about which he had only read, and, blessed with keen intelligence and an eye for detail, he recreated that land in his writing. Cut off from his family and friends back home, he poured his thoughts and feelings into letters, which form a riveting narrative of the adventurous life he led in the far north.

Seeking riches, he found them not in the nuggets he dug from the frozen mountains but in the human relationships he mined in the tiny gold-rush towns and camps.

Hunter searched not only for fame and fortune, but also for an understanding of his place in this world. His letters reveal one individual’s quest for purpose and meaning in life. His determination and hope in the face of daunting obstacles, both physical and spiritual, is a testament to man’s courage.

JOANN ROBERTSON'S GRANDFATHER MOVED TO THE YUKON in 1897 to make his fortune. He did not succeed at that, but he did fall in love with the North. From memories of her Yukon youth to family letters, photographs, news clippings and more, Joann brings to life the experiences of her family and others during this little-known period of Yukon history. This narrative--at one point describing the dismantling of a Model T Ford to smuggle it by canoe across a river in the dead of night--echoes her love of this unique society.
